在Ubuntu中作为守护进程运行ElasticSearch时出错
在ubuntu中作为守护进程运行elasticsearch时,我遇到以下错误:在Ubuntu中作为守护进程运行ElasticSearch时出错,ubuntu,elasticsearch,daemon,Ubuntu,elasticsearch,Daemon,在ubuntu中作为守护进程运行elasticsearch时,我遇到以下错误: daemon: fatal: failed to tell if ./elasticsearch is safe: No such file or directory 但是,当我尝试手动运行该命令时,它会起作用: ./bin/elasticsearch -d -p pid 请告知如何修复此问题 我想是我的小姐。显然,我安装了一个不正确的软件包,我是从TAR安装的。然而,我应该从DEB安装 所以,我从弹性体开始 从
daemon: fatal: failed to tell if ./elasticsearch is safe: No such file or directory
但是,当我尝试手动运行该命令时,它会起作用:
./bin/elasticsearch -d -p pid
请告知如何修复此问题 我想是我的小姐。显然,我安装了一个不正确的软件包,我是从TAR安装的。然而,我应该从DEB安装 所以,我从弹性体开始 从APT存储库安装 在继续之前,您可能需要在Debian上安装apt传输https包:
sudo-apt-get-install-apt-transport-https
将存储库定义保存到/etc/apt/sources.list.d/elastic-6.x.list:
echo“debhttps://artifacts.elastic.co/packages/6.x/apt 稳定主“sudo-tee-a/etc/apt/sources.list.d/elastic-6.x.list
sudo-apt-get-update&&sudo-apt-get-install-elasticsearch
但是因为我想要一个特定的版本6.2.4,所以我使用了这个:sudo-apt-get-update&&sudo-apt-get-install-elasticsearch=6.2.4
使用SysV initedit运行Elasticsearch使用update rc.d命令将Elasticsearch配置为在系统启动时自动启动:
sudo更新rc.d elasticsearch默认值95 10
可以使用服务命令启动和停止Elasticsearch:
sudo-i服务弹性搜索开始
sudo-i服务弹性搜索站
如果Elasticsearch因任何原因无法启动,它将打印失败原因到STDOUT。日志文件可在/var/Log/elasticsearch/中找到